Band intensities in the absorption spectrum of benzene vapour

Abstract
The transition intensities of a large number of different progressions in the absorption spectra of benzene-h6 and -d6 were carefully measured, photo-electrically. Overall, the results are in agreement with the Franck-Condon factors predicted on the basis of Herzberg-Teller theory for a C-C bond length change of between 0·032 to 0·034 Å. Significant deviations do exist, not all of which can be readily ascribed to assigned Fermi resonances.
